Ticket: Staging env misconfigured for Siftgate bloom filter

The bloom layer in front of the Pellet KV store is rejecting all lookups in staging because the env file was copied from the dev template without credentials. False-positive tuning values are fine; only the auth line is missing. To unblock the weekly demo, the Pellet admission secret must be set on the following line.

env line for yaguf-fajop: LEDGER_TOKEN13=fb08984397349

## PointsLedger Environments

Welcome aboard. The Meridex loyalty-points ledger runs in three environments: sandbox, staging, and production. Each keeps its own balance database and event stream; never point a sandbox writer at staging. Contractors get sandbox access by default, and promotions to staging require a lead's sign-off. Before running any local job, confirm your environment matches the values below.

settings of tagef-bawif:
DRUIX_HOST=druix.zemvarlabs.internal
DRUIX_PORT=8000

## Artifact Signing and Trace Propagation

All builds produced by the Hollowmere pipeline must be signed before the trace-router service will accept their deployment events. When debugging a request that spans gatekeeper, ledgerd, and the fanout workers, confirm the trace ID survives the signing step — unsigned artifacts drop their span context silently. If you are paged for missing spans, verify the signer first. Signing is performed with the key below.

deploy key for kahof-tadup: bky4_rRMZ